Output 3b040e587dda9599ebb9bb720d1cb97ef4179ae224cca805b36d6d35abc5e4cf:24

value
92444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e525914c06349b0c981a8d6b52310ebdc86f44ad OP_EQUAL
address
3NadfiKQqYiYKF18mzJGJHArtUtL7isj44
transaction
3b040e587dda9599ebb9bb720d1cb97ef4179ae224cca805b36d6d35abc5e4cf
confirmations
289965
spent
true